Imported Upstream version 2.5.0
[debian/amanda] / dumper-src / Makefile.am
diff --git a/dumper-src/Makefile.am b/dumper-src/Makefile.am
new file mode 100644 (file)
index 0000000..0b4b739
--- /dev/null
@@ -0,0 +1,33 @@
+# Makefile for Amanda wrapper programs.
+
+INCLUDES =     -I$(top_builddir)/common-src \
+               -I$(top_srcdir)/common-src
+
+dumper_SCRIPTS =       gnutar generic-dumper
+dumperdir =            @DUMPER_DIR@
+
+SUFFIXES =             .sh .pl
+
+.pl:
+                       cat $< > $@
+                       chmod a+x $@
+                       -test -z "$(PERL)" || $(PERL) -c $@
+
+.sh:
+                       cat $< > $@
+                       chmod a+x $@
+
+DISTCLEANFILES = $(dumper_SCRIPTS)
+
+# these are used for testing only:
+
+install-data-hook:
+       @list="$(dumper_SCRIPTS)"; \
+       for p in $$list; do \
+               pa=$(DESTDIR)$(dumperdir)/`echo $$p|sed '$(transform)'`; \
+               echo chown $(BINARY_OWNER) $$pa; \
+               chown $(BINARY_OWNER) $$pa; \
+               echo chgrp $(SETUID_GROUP) $$pa; \
+               chgrp $(SETUID_GROUP) $$pa; \
+       done
+